                The most scenic way from Chattanooga to Charlotte is to go to Cleveland TN on I-24, then US 74 (and I-40/74) to Charlotte. Using this route there is approx. 50 miles of two lane from Ocoee, TN to Bryson City, NC. We are staying in Cleveland Thursday night to get an early start where we can enjoy the drive.
